Snow Cleaning Vehicles Market Key Growth Drivers and Demand Factors

The global snow cleaning vehicles market was valued at USD 4.68 billion in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 7.25 bill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 5.0% during the forecast period 2025-2033.

The snow cleaning vehicles market experiences steady expansion driven by fundamental infrastructure maintenance requirements and climate-related demand patterns. Extreme weather events and unpredictable winter conditions accelerate municipal investment in advanced snow removal capabilities ensuring transportation system reliability. Aging snow plow and snow removal equipment across developed economies necessitates comprehensive replacement programs supporting continued operational effectiveness.

Urban area expansion and infrastructure development create increased snow removal requirements across expanding metropolitan regions. Highway system maintenance standards mandate reliable snow clearing capabilities ensuring vehicle safety during winter weather events. Transportation safety regulations expand, requiring municipalities maintaining clear roadways regardless of weather conditions. Private contractor demand for snow removal services expands, creating equipment replacement and upgrade cycles.

Climate variability intensifying winter severity in certain regions drives demand for advanced snow removal capabilities. Electric vehicle adoption by municipalities creates demand for electric snow removal equipment supporting sustainability objectives. Autonomous snow removal vehicle development represents emerging growth opportunity supporting unmanned operation capabilities.

Public private partnership expansion enables equipment sharing and utilization optimization. Real estate development across northern climates creates new snow removal requirements. Tourism industry growth in winter destination areas drives infrastructure maintenance investment. Environmental regulations restricting chemical de-icing promote mechanical snow removal equipment adoption.

Equipment efficiency improvement demand drives technological advancement and equipment modernization. Integrated sensor technologies enabling real-time snow event response support operational optimization. Fuel efficiency improvements reduce operating costs and environmental impact.

Snow Cleaning Vehicles Market Challenges, Risks and Market Barriers

The snow cleaning vehicles market faces significant challenges from seasonal demand variability creating equipment utilization constraints. Mild winter seasons reduce snow removal requirements, creating demand uncertainty and equipment investment hesitation. High upfront equipment costs limit adoption among smaller municipal agencies and private contractors.

Skilled operator scarcity limits effective equipment utilization and operational efficiency. Equipment maintenance complexity creates operational challenges and downtime risks. Storage requirements for seasonal equipment constrain municipal facility capacity. Supply chain disruptions affecting vehicle components complicate manufacturing and delivery timelines.

Environmental regulations regarding salt application and stormwater runoff create operational constraints. Competing snow management methodologies create technology uncertainty. Equipment standardization gaps between manufacturers complicate spare parts availability.
